> #if Kelly Lynn Martin
> > My main gripe with rpm is that it's virtually impossible to convince
> > rpm that you've installed an equivalent by other means.  You can
> > --nodeps, but that defeats the entire point of dependency testing.
> 
> What about --justdb ? If you want to pretend you've installed something,
> that works quite nicely.

You would have to have a package providing what is missing which is not
always the case.
